Abstract
A simple resolution of the electron translation factor problem in the ion-atom collision theory is presented, in which the perturbed stationary states (PSS) are retained but the asymptotic boundary conditions are automatically satisfied without additional adjustment factors. A mathematically consistent theory was formulated previously in terms of the adiabatically distorted cluster states, which is compared here with the PSS to clarify the difficulties involved. The PSS approach is not convenient when corrections of the order of the electron-ion mass ratio are to be included. An improved calculational procedure using a simple electron translation factor without the channel-switching function is suggested.
